Description of problem:
Every time Publican creates a directory it should check for success and croak
with a useful message if it fails.
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
publican-2.7
How reproducible:
Easy
Steps to Reproduce:
1. cd to a book as a normal user
2. create tmp dir
3. chown root:root tmp
4: run publican build
Actual results:
Weird errors
Expected results:
"Can't create directory $dir $why"
